Summary
This high-performance integrated differential amplifier is designed for demanding audio applications requiring robust receiving of balanced line inputs and superior noise immunity. Key features include exceptional common-mode rejection (90 dB) and ultra-low THD, ensuring signal integrity even over long cable runs. Frequently Asked Questions
What is the Common-Mode Rejection (CMR)?
The SSM2143 provides a typical 90 dB of common-mode rejection, which decreases gracefully at higher frequencies.
Can this device operate with a gain other than 1/2?
Yes, while primarily for G=1/2 applications, a gain of 2 can be achieved by reversing the +IN/–IN and SENSE/REFERENCE connections. A gain of 2 is also possible using SSM2142.
What is the maximum differential input signal handling capability?
The SSM2143 input stage is designed to handle input signals up to +28 dBu at a gain of 1/2.
